# Please direct questions and support issues to # # Cared for by Shawn Hoon # # Copyright Shawn Hoon # # You may distribute this module under the same terms as perl itself # POD documentation - main docs before the code =head1 NAME Bio::Tools::Run::Vista Wrapper for Vista =head1 SYNOPSIS use Bio::Tools::Run::Vista; use Bio::Tools::Run::Alignment::Lagan; use Bio::AlignIO; my $sio = Bio::SeqIO->new(-file=>$ARGV[0],-format=>'genbank'); my @seq; my $reference = $sio->next_seq; push @seq, $reference; while(my $seq = $sio->next_seq){ push @seq,$seq; } my @features = grep{$_->primary_tag eq 'CDS'} $reference->get_SeqFeatures; my $lagan = Bio::Tools::Run::Alignment::Lagan->new; my $aln = $lagan->mlagan(\@seq,'(fugu (mouse human))'); my $vis = Bio::Tools::Run::Vista->new('outfile'=>"outfile.pdf", 'title' => "My Vista Plot", 'annotation'=>\@features, 'annotation_format'=>'GFF', 'min_perc_id'=>75, 'min_length'=>100, 'plotmin' => 50, 'tickdist' => 2000, 'window'=>40, 'numwindows'=>4, 'start'=>50, 'end'=>1500, 'tickdist'=>100, 'bases'=>1000, 'java_param'=>"-Xmx128m", 'num_pages'=>1, 'color'=> {'EXON'=>'100 0 0', 'CNS'=>'0 0 100'}, 'quiet'=>1); my $referenceid= 'human'; $vis->run($aln,$referenceid); #alternative one can choose pairwise alignments to plot #where the second id in each pair is the reference sequence $vis->run($aln,([mouse,human],[fugu,human],[mouse,fugu])); =head1 DESCRIPTION Pls see Vista documentation for plotfile options Wrapper for Vista : C. Mayor, M. Brudno, J. R. Schwartz, A. Poliakov, E. M. Rubin, K. A. Frazer, L. S. Pachter, I. Dubchak. VISTA: Visualizing global DNA sequence alignments of arbitrary length. Bioinformatics, 2000 Nov;16(11):1046-1047. Get it here: http://www-gsd.lbl.gov/vista/VISTAdownload2.html On the command line, it is assumed that this can be executed: java Vista plotfile Some of the code was adapted from MLAGAN toolkit M.
